Forex Scam Detection: Red Flags to Watch Out For

Navigating the world of forex trading can be treacherous. illegitimate schemes are prevalent, preying on unsuspecting individuals seeking financial gains. Recognizing these warning signs is paramount to protecting yourself from falling victim to a scam. Be wary of promises of easy money, as these are often too good to be true. Legitimate forex brokers never assure consistent or exceptional profits, as market fluctuations are inherent to the industry.

Remember, if it seems too good to be true, it probably is. Stay informed, exercise caution, and protect your financial well-being by rejecting potential forex scams.

Is Your Broker Legitimate?

Investing your hard-earned savings requires careful consideration and choosing the right broker. But with so many brokers to consider, how can you verify that your chosen broker is legitimate? It's important to preserve your investments and avoid falling prey to unscrupulous practices. Begin by researching their credentials. Look for licenses from reputable agencies, such as the Financial Industry Regulatory Authority (FINRA).

Furthermore, examine online reviews from other investors. Take special regard to patterns in the feedback. If you see red flags, it's wise to proceed with caution.
